Do you ever find yourself dealing with difficult reactions from those who do not believe?

Do you have doubts at times?

Katherine T Owen pursued the spiritual journey whilst she was ill and bedbound for fourteen years.

At a time when she could barely speak, she found her head filling with inspirations – poems and thought-bites which moved her forward.

In It’s OK to Believe she asks and answers the questions asked by many who seek the truth.

Questions such as:

  • Why can't we see and prove God?
  • What role does imagination play in the spiritual journey?
  • How do religion and spirituality compare?
  • How can more than one religion be right?
  • Can faith and reason go together? Can faith be rational?

Journey with her.

Enjoy the beauty of poetic text.

Engage in simple practices of forgiveness.

Reflect on powerful spiritual quotes.

Imagine a loving God, Spirit, Presence, and step into that reality.

Allow Katherine T Owen’s poems about faith and reason to move you from the chattering head into the heart of God.


It's OK to Believe is a work of 360 pages, consisting of 281 inspirations - spiritual poems and thoughtbites, 281 releases, and 281 spiritual quotes.
